In 2019, Apollo Micro Systems implemented TCS iON Manufacturing ERP under vendor Tata Consultancy Services, bringing the application into procurement and material workflows at its Hyderabad site. The deployment of TCS iON Manufacturing ERP was operational during the period when a Purchase Executive managed procurement activities from March 2019 to July 2022, indicating direct use of the system for purchase lifecycle tasks. The entry situates this work within the Manufacturing ERP category and ties the application to company purchasing operations in Hyderabad.
The implementation focused on procurement and inventory related capabilities within the Manufacturing ERP scope, with functional use cases including creating purchase orders from the ERP, floating enquiries to suppliers, tracking material receipts and movements, and preparing comparative statements to support vendor selection. The TCS iON Manufacturing ERP instance was used to prepare documents for payments and to manage documentation required for clearing customs, reflecting purchase to pay and compliance oriented configuration and transaction capture. These modules were configured to support routine procurement workflows and material tracking consistent with manufacturing operations.
Operational coverage emphasized the Procurement function and adjacent Finance and customs clearance activities, with the Purchase Executive role executing procurement, negotiation, order issuance, material tracking, and payment documentation inside the ERP. Governance and process changes are visible in the shift of purchase order creation and enquiry management into the TCS iON Manufacturing ERP, and the system served as the record of procurement transactions and customs documentation for the Hyderabad operation.
